چرا استفاده از انتزاع در طراحی برنامه ها میتواند به کاهش پیچیدگی و ابهام در کد منجر شود؟
توضیحات:
استفاده از انتزاع در طراحی برنامهها میتواند به کاهش پیچیدگی و ابهام در کد منجر شود زیرا:
سطح بالاتر از انتزاع: با استفاده از انتزاع، میتوانید اجزای مختلف برنامه را به صورت مستقل و منطقی مدلسازی کنید و هر کدام را به عنوان یک واحد کاری جداگانه در نظر بگیرید. این باعث میشود که کد شما به صورت سلسله مراتبی و ساختاری سازماندهی شود و از پیچیدگیها و ابهامات ناشی از تداخل و تداخل بین اجزاهای مختلف کاسته شود.
انتزاع مفهومی: با استفاده از انتزاع، میتوانید مفاهیم و عملیات مختلف برنامه را به صورت مستقل از جزئیات پیادهسازی مدلسازی کنید. این باعث میشود که کد شما به صورت خواناتر و قابل فهمتر باشد و از ابهامات ناشی از جزئیات فنی و تکنیکی کاسته شود.
افزایش قابلیت نگهداری: با استفاده از انتزاع، میتوانید اجزای مختلف برنامه را به صورت مستقل و قابل تعویض مدلسازی کنید. این باعث میشود که تغییرات و بهروزرسانیهای مختلف را به راحتی اعمال کنید و از ابهامات و مشکلات ناشی از وابستگیهای زیاد بین اجزاهای مختلف کاسته شود.
بنابراین، استفاده از انتزاع در طراحی برنامهها میتواند به کاهش پیچیدگی و ابهام در کد منجر شود و از مزایای خواناتری، قابل نگهداریتری و انعطافپذیرتری برنامه شما بهرهمند شود.
موفق باشید
A.J
پست های مرتبط:
فروشگاه سورسا:
سورسا ، یک خانواده!
شما میتوانید از سورس های آماده به راحتی و با کپی پیست در پروژه خود استفاده بفرمایید
بله! سورسا به عنوان اولین و برترین مرجع سورس کد های آماده، تمامی سورس کد ها در زبان های مختلف را به صورت رایگان در اختیار شما قرار میدهد.
اگر سورس مد نظر شما تفاوتی با سورس فعلی دارد یا اینکه درخواست سورس دیگری را دارید میتوانید با کارشناسان سورسا در ارتباط باشید.
سورسا به عنوان مرجع سورس در تلاش است سورس کد ها و آموزش های تمامی زبان های برنامه نویسی مانند GO C++ Python C PHP SQL JS و… را تحت پوشش قرار داد